你查询的IP:[122.51.101.178]  地理位置:中国–上海–上海

最新查询122.136.183.194 117.80.24.98 218.152.169.211 60.128.132.35 125.169.183.53 117.24.12.183 116.13.45.73 60.101.132.2 222.176.196.3 218.183.101.12 221.195.244.45 122.51.101.178 124.242.255.210 202.189.80.216 125.64.190.93 58.240.167.12 118.184.222.163 202.148.96.47 210.12.84.121 116.76.211.1 119.18.208.8 221.199.224.131 202.143.16.85 58.192.117.108 202.130.224.225 202.181.112.209 202.173.224.39 202.223.110.213 203.100.96.163 59.64.38.110 60.208.146.175 121.4.44.19 118.24.100.131